diff --git a/botan/doc/thanks.txt b/botan/doc/thanks.txt new file mode 100644 index 0000000..caa2fb5 --- /dev/null +++ b/botan/doc/thanks.txt @@ -0,0 +1,49 @@ + +The following people (sorted alphabetically) contributed bug reports, useful +information, or were generally just helpful people to talk to: + +Jeff B +Rickard Bondesson +Mike Desjardins +Matthew Gregan +Hany Greiss +Friedemann Kleint +Ying-Chieh Liao +Dan Nicolaescu +Vaclav Ovsik +Ken Perano +Darren Starsmore +Kaushik Veeraraghavan +Dominik Vogt +James Widener + +Cerulean Studios, creators of the Trillian instant messaging client, +has provided financial assistance to the project. + +Barry Kavanagh of AEP Systems Ltd kindly provided an AEP2000 crypto card and +drivers, enabling the creation of Botan's AEP engine module. + +In addition, the following people have unknowingly contributed help: + + Dean Gaudet <dean@arctic.org> wrote the SSE2 implementation of SHA-1 + + The implementation of DES is based off a public domain implementation by Phil + Karn from 1994 (he, in turn, credits Richard Outerbridge and Jim Gillogly). + + Rijndael and Square are based on the reference implementations written by + the inventors, Joan Daemen and Vincent Rijmen. + + The Serpent S-boxes used were discovered by Dag Arne Osvik and detailed in + his paper "Speeding Up Serpent". + + Matthew Skala's public domain twofish.c (as given in GnuPG 0.9.8) provided + the basis for my Twofish code (particularly the key schedule). + + Some of the hash functions (MD5, SHA-1, etc) use an optimized implementation + of one of the boolean functions, which was discovered by Colin Plumb. + + The design of Randpool takes some of it's design principles from those + suggested by Eric A. Young in his SSLeay documentation, Peter Gutmann's paper + "Software Generation of Practically Strong Random Numbers", and the paper + "Cryptanalytic Attacks on Pseudorandom Number Generators", by Kelsey, + Schneier, Wagner, and Hall. |
